Types of E-Commerce Platforms
Online businesses need e-commerce platforms to build their virtual platform. Online selling platforms exist today in three core categories which include hosted solutions and self-hosted solutions and open-source platforms. Each platform type brings different advantages as well as disadvantages with particular aspects.
Hosted solutions like Shopify as well as BigCommerce offer users a whole platform package. Through their platform users experience an intuitive interface which includes payment processing capabilities as well as hosting services to speed up business launch times. The main advantage of hosted solutions is their simple deployment because they need basic technological skills from users. Users experience challenges when attempting to customize and control their online store through these solutions although this restricts businesses who demand particular features.
The range of control over an online store becomes greater for business owners who choose self-hosted solutions such as WooCommerce and Magento. Users who opt for these platforms must buy their own web hosting services before using the platform features. The main advantage of self-hosted solutions lies in their flexible characteristics because businesses have total control to modify features and designs according to their unique needs. The advantage brings its disadvantage because proper management and maintenance of the platform requires advanced technical proficiency.
Open-source platforms including PrestaShop and OpenCart give developers essential capabilities to transform and improve the platform code according to their business specifications. Open-source platforms suit businesses which have special requirements because they provide customization options. EventArgs operating an open-source platform receive maximum customization benefits which enable enhanced development potential throughout time. Open-source adoption demands substantial development costs from businesses especially those with restricted funds or restricted resources.

E-Commerce Tools and Plugins: Enhancing Your Platform
The e-commerce environment needs tools and plugins to enable businesses enhance their online performance. The supplementary tools help extend e-commerce system capabilities which enables businesses to connect better with customers and optimize their workflow and monitor performance data. The market provides different types of tools which solve particular problems for online merchants.
The improvement of website visibility in search engines relies completely on Search Engine Optimization (SEO) tools. The search engine optimization software Yoast SEO for WordPress alongside SEMrush enables companies to optimize their webpage content for enhanced organic traffic. The integration of keyword optimization and readability analysis and sitemap features through these tools helps users rise higher in search engine result rankings.
E-commerce depends on email marketing as a fundamental technique for business communication. Mailchimp and Klaviyo provide businesses with tools to maintain customer connections through individual marketing communications and promotional messages. These platform tools provide businesses with accessible design templates and sequencing automation and thorough analytics that help organizations build communication messages which connect with their target recipients.
Companies need CRM tools such as HubSpot or Salesforce to both monitor and manage comprehensive customer interactions through their relationships. These tools enable organizations to discover what customers prefer which improves their marketing practices and strengthens their customer base retention rates.
The analytics tools Google Analytics and Hotjar generate beneficial data about both customer interactions and sales statistics. Through the integration of these analytics plugins businesses can use data to drive their choices because it lets them modify their offerings and marketing approach to meet consumer needs properly.
The last feature of social media integration tools allows businesses to perform easy promotions across multiple digital platforms. Through Buffer and Hootsuite businesses gain easy solutions to manage their social media by creating post schedules and customer engagement and assessing performance metrics in a streamlined way.
The addition of proper tools and plugins substantially contributes to e-commerce operation success. Business goals find their alignment through strategic enhancement choices that lead companies to build powerful online platforms which successfully keep both new and existing customers.

Security Considerations for E-Commerce Transactions
Security in e-commerce is a paramount concern for both businesses and consumers. As online transactions continue to grow, so does the necessity for robust security measures to protect sensitive information. One of the foremost aspects of e-commerce security is secure payment processing. Utilizing proven payment gateways that comply with current security standards is crucial. Ensuring that payment information is processed through secure, encrypted channels helps to minimize the risk of data breaches. It is imperative that businesses select payment processors that employ strong encryption methods to safeguard user data.
Data encryption is another essential element when it comes to e-commerce security. Implementing SSL certification is a common practice that can secure the connection between the customer and the website, thereby preventing unauthorized access to sensitive information during transmission. This measure not only enhances security but also builds customer trust, as consumers are more likely to complete transactions on websites that visibly convey their commitment to security.
Compliance with established security standards, such as the Payment Card Industry Data Security Standards (PCI DSS), is also a requirement for e-commerce platforms. These guidelines are designed to ensure that all companies processing credit card information maintain a secure environment. Adhering to PCI DSS not only mitigates potential vulnerabilities but also reassures customers about the integrity of their transactions.
Furthermore, protecting customer data extends beyond financial information. E-commerce businesses must prioritize comprehensive data protection strategies that encompass personal details, order history, and login credentials. This involves regular software updates, employing encryption for stored data, and educating employees about potential security threats. By adopting these best practices, e-commerce platforms can significantly reduce the risks associated with online transactions, ultimately fostering a safer shopping environment for consumers.
Future Trends in E-Commerce Platforms
The landscape of e-commerce is evolving rapidly, with various trends shaping the future of online selling. One of the most significant advancements is the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) within e-commerce platforms. AI-powered features enhance customer personalization by analyzing user behavior and preferences. This allows platforms to offer tailored recommendations, dynamic pricing, and even automated customer service solutions, thus improving the overall shopping experience.
Another critical trend gaining traction is the importance of omnichannel selling. Businesses are increasingly recognizing the need to provide a seamless experience across multiple channels, whether it be physical stores, online shops, or mobile applications. Omnichannel strategies ensure that customers can interact with brands harmoniously, leading to enhanced customer satisfaction and loyalty. E-commerce platforms are responding by offering tools that enable retailers to manage inventory, sales, and customer data across all touchpoints effectively.
Advancements in payment technologies also play a pivotal role in the future of e-commerce. With the growing acceptance of cryptocurrency, e-commerce platforms are adapting to offer crypto payments alongside traditional methods. This not only caters to a diverse customer base but also enhances transaction security measures. Integration of various payment options allows businesses to provide convenience and flexibility, appealing to a broader audience and potentially increasing sales.
Moreover, the integration of aug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) technologies is set to revolutionize customer experience. These technologies allow customers to visualize products in their real-world context or experience them in immersive environments before making a purchase. As e-commerce platforms continue to leverage AR and VR features, they are expected to significantly enhance customer engagement, leading to higher conversion rates and enhanced brand loyalty.
